A screw conveyor generally consists of a rotating helical screw, also known as a flight, positioned inside a trough, tube, or other housing. As the screw rotates, it moves material along the conveyor. The simplicity of this design makes screw conveyors versatile and relatively easy to integrate into existing material-handling systems. Depending on the application, manufacturers can supply horizontal, inclined, or specialized configurations.

Manufacturers can consider factors such as conveyor length, diameter, screw speed, material density, temperature, moisture content, and required throughput when developing a suitable system. Different screw flight designs and construction materials can also be selected according to the demands of the application.

Durability is another important consideration when choosing a screw conveyor. Industrial environments can expose equipment to abrasive, corrosive, wet, or high-temperature materials. Quality manufacturers can offer components constructed from appropriate grades of carbon steel, stainless steel, or other materials to help improve service life. Properly selected bearings, seals, drives, and other components can further contribute to reliable operation.

For agricultural operations, screw conveyors are commonly used to move grain, feed, seed, and other bulk products. Food-processing facilities may require sanitary designs that support cleanliness and meet applicable industry requirements. Wastewater and environmental facilities can use specialized screw conveyors for transporting screenings, sludge, and dewatered materials. Manufacturing and industrial plants may use them to move powders, chemicals, minerals, or production materials between different stages of a process.

Energy efficiency and maintenance should also be considered when selecting conveyor equipment. A properly sized screw conveyor can provide effective material movement without unnecessary power consumption. Designs that allow convenient access to wear components and inspection points can make routine maintenance easier, potentially reducing downtime and operating costs.
